Marc Meihuizen, 1968 Pontiac Firebird, Pro Mod
![]() | Carbon fibre body as delivered from Cynergy Composites. Click body catalogue to see more of their offerings. |
![]() | Early stages on the chassis jig with body and axle mocked up in place and first frame rails in position. |
![]() | Main cage in place with front and rear extensions. |
![]() | Axle case with four link bars and track locator. This is not a new use of cardboard for wheel tubs but a template which will be used later when the tubs are made in carbon fibre. |
![]() | A little while later and many more tubes in place; full back support, funny car cage and triangulation of main chassis rails. |
![]() | Top view shows x-member with slip joint bracing bottom frame rails. Motor plate in place but not yet trimmed to size. Dummy block used develop front mounts and braces. |
![]() | Driver's seat area with support and framing for carbon fibre seat. |
![]() | Bespoke pedals share common cross shaft. Shaft coming from bottom right links brake lever and pedal, and forward link goes to master cylinder. |
![]() | Not quite a "Birdcage" Maserati but there are a lot of tubes in a Pro Mod. |
![]() | Bespoke fuel and oil tanks with Pontiac logo pressed into mount and forward breather just at the bottom of the picture. |
![]() | Body mount framework held by pip pins. These need to be easily removable to remove headers should a head change be necessary ... a frequent occurrence on Pro Mods. |

Back from paint with final detailing to be done eg Firebird emblem at the front of the wing, already in place on the blower belt guard.
|
![]() | Top fuel style titanium shield behind driver protects against catastrophic tyre failure. |
![]() | The crew push Marc down for his first observed run at the FIA Main Event, 2009 at Santa Pod. |

![]() | In the staging lanes at the FHRA Nitro Nationals, Alastaro, Finland in 2009. Click Finland burnout to see Marc in action. |
![]() | New replacement front end and the old which was damaged in a staging lanes incident at Hockenheim |
